Problem:
The client is attempting to copy content from an ACF block to a translated page using the WPML editor. However, instead of seeing the translated content, all content is being copied from the default language.
Solution:
We tested by switching the theme to Twenty Twenty-Four and deactivating all third-party plugins, leaving only ACF and WPML active. Using WPML's Classic Translation Editor, the image and link were successfully copied to other languages. We recommend using WPML's Translation Editor to copy the fields to other languages. If you need to use the WordPress editor instead, please contact us for further assistance.

The meaning of "Copy once" is: Copies the field value to translations just once, allowing you to independently modify the field values in translations afterward.

So you will not see it in the translations after the first time.
